Responsibilities:
This role provides comprehensive administrative support to key leadership, including the International Executive Director and the Executive Director of the NYC Team, Regional Advancement. Responsibilities include managing calendars, preparing reports and documents, and supporting gift officers through bi-weekly meetings, donor visit preparations, and proposal creation. The position involves processing expense reports, invoices, and updating OASIS, Workday, and other systems to ensure accurate and timely financial management and data updates. Additionally, the role encompasses international support, including managing international gift-giving customs, maintaining country-specific reports, coordinating international travel for senior staff, and preparing multi-currency expense reports. Effective communication with high-level donors, senior executives, and staff is essential.
